What’s involved in an office removal?

  1. Planning

The first step when moving office is to plan. Although domestic moves require planning too, it’s especially important with an office since it can disrupt the business quite significantly if it isn’t planned properly.

The first thing you should do is create a planning committee. This will allow you to assign specific roles to each person, whether it’s budgeting, opportunity identification or communicating about the move with other staff.

The next step is to create a specific timeline for the move. What this looks like and how long it takes will depend on the size of the business. Large moves should allow at least 6 months in order to minimise disruption to the business and give you enough time to prepare.

  1. Contact office removal company

It’s a good idea to contact an office removal company early on in the process. They will visit the office and conduct a full survey, including the estimated amount of packing materials required. They will also give you a quote for the cost of the move. It’s always recommended to get quotes from more than one company so you can make an informed decision and get the best price possible.

  1. Packing

When you’re ready to make the move, the removal company will pack the items in the office. Usually smaller items and personal effects are placed in smaller crates, with larger crates being used for equipment such as monitors and printers.

A good office removal company will be able to remove the equipment from your office in the safest way possible. This is very important with office removals since there’s usually very expensive and easily damaged equipment to be moved.

How much does an office removal cost?

If your company is relocating to a new office, then you’re likely wondering just how much it will cost to hire a removal company.

Some of the main things that affect the cost of an office removal are –

  • The size of the office – Office removal companies usually charge per square foot. This means, the larger your office, the more you can expect to pay. The exact rate varies from one company to the next but it’s usually somewhere between £20-60 per square foot.
  • Premises survey – Some office removal companies will provide a survey of the premises free of charge but this isn’t always the case, especially for larger offices where a survey might take a considerable amount of time.
  • Storage – Another thing that can add to the cost is if you require storage. Depending on the size of the office and number of items to be moved, it might be better to do it gradually. In this case, it’s very useful to have someone secure to store any items before moving them to the new office. Most removal companies will be able to provide this service at an additional cost.

Hiring the right office removals company 

Below are some of the most important things to consider when hiring an office moving company.

  • Services offered – One of the first things to find out when you’re researching office removal companies is the services they offer. Any good removal company will be able to assist with office removals but the services they offer can vary a lot. If you require additional services, such as cleaning, packing, storage etc. then it’s important to find out upfront which companies offer this so you can narrow them down.
  • Availability – Availability will always be one of the first things you need to find out from any office removal companies you contact. Office removals tend to require a lot of planning, so provided you contact companies early in the process, you shouldn’t have any trouble finding ones that are available at the time you need.
  • Professionalism – Professionalism is a very important factor to consider when looking for an office removal company. You can judge the professionalism of a company in numerous ways, from your first conversation with them on the telephone to their website and how they carry out the survey of your office.
  • Experience – Experience is a big thing to take into account too. Since you’ll need to trust the valuable equipment in your office to the company you hire, you want to be sure that they have the right experience and equipment to transport it safely.

Saving money when moving offices 

Hiring an office removal company can be quite expensive, so it’s a good idea to take any steps you can to save money when moving offices. Below are some of the best ways to do this.

  • Get quotes from several companies – One of the best ways to save money when you’re moving offices is to get quotes from several different removal companies. Having multiple quotes will allow you to easily assess what each company is offering and make an informed decision on which one to pick.
  • Declutter your current office – Another way you can save money is by decluttering your current office as much as possible. Getting rid of unwanted or unneeded equipment will help to reduce the overall volume of items that need to be moved when you relocate.
  • Plan ahead – Planning ahead is always important with any type of move, especially so for an office move. You need to think about the timeline of the move as well as researching office removal companies. Planning the move will almost certainly save you money since you can think about how to do it in a way that will cause the least disruption to the business.
  • Book a moving company early – The earlier you book a removal company, the better. Not only does this give you plenty of time to properly plan and prepare but it also means you’ll save money compared to if you booked at the last minute.
  • Negotiate – Depending on the size of your move and the company you speak to, you may be able to negotiate a better price, particularly if you have a cheaper quote from a competing removal company.
  • Plan the move for an off-peak time – If the date of the relocation is in your hands, then it’s a good idea to plan it for an off-peak time if at all possible. Most removals, both domestic and commercial, take place in the spring and summer months. This makes sense due to the more favourable weather conditions and longer daylight hours. However, if you can plan it outside these times, then you could save a considerable amount of money.
